چکیده انگلیسی
A synthetic procedure based on thermal hydrolysis of iron(III) chloride solutions for the preparation of hematite (α-Fe2O3) sol consisting of nano-crystals (NCs) is described. The α-Fe2O3 NCs were characterized by transmission electron microscopy and X-ray diffraction measurements. Incorporation of α-Fe2O3 NCs into polystyrene (PS) was based on the transfer of α-Fe2O3 NCs from the aqueous phase to the organic solvent. A significant shift in the glass transition temperature of PS by 17 °C towards higher temperatures was observed after incorporation of α-Fe2O3 NCs. Also, the thermal stability of PS was improved by about 100 °C in the presence of 3.6 wt% of α-Fe2O3 NCs.
